We are installing allot of Hdpe Water pipe and want to show the pipe

with a Vertical and Horizontal curve as opposed to just straight pipe with bends.

(plan view is easy)

We know we can do it manually in the profile. Is there a way to

get the Pipe Network to follow a Vertical curve in the profile?:unsure:

Posted

As far as I know, Civil 3D forces you to run pipes between structures, i.e. straight lines from point to point. I'm not saying you can't have a curved pipe, just that I don't know how to do it.

Posted

Sounds like a 3d polyline question or a series of straights and arcs but with the arcs rotated about an axis

 

300mm rad 90 bend inclined 45deg to left, remember a rotated bend from plan view is shorter now if not 90deg when viewed in plan

 

Could be done but not in civ3d pipe. it would be fairly simple to write a lisp to enter the details and "rotate3d" the object.
